The Cost Of Benchtop Lyophilizers: Factors Affecting Price

Benchtop lyophilizers are versatile laboratory equipment used for the dehydration of samples through the process of freeze-drying They are essential tools in various industries such as pharmaceuticals, food, and research, making them sought after by many laboratories When considering purchasing a benchtop lyophilizer, one of the key factors that need to be taken into account is the price In this article, we will explore the factors that influence the price of benchtop lyophilizers and provide insight into what to expect when investing in this type of equipment.

1 Capacity

One of the primary factors that affect the price of a benchtop lyophilizer is its capacity The capacity of a lyophilizer is measured in terms of the volume of samples it can accommodate during the freeze-drying process Benchtop lyophilizers come in a range of sizes, typically ranging from a few liters to 10 liters or more A larger capacity lyophilizer will come at a higher price compared to a smaller capacity unit, as it requires more materials and components to construct.

2 Cooling System

Another factor that influences the cost of a benchtop lyophilizer is the type of cooling system it utilizes There are two main types of cooling systems used in lyophilizers: air-cooled and water-cooled Air-cooled systems are generally more affordable but may be limited in their cooling capacity compared to water-cooled systems Water-cooled lyophilizers tend to be more expensive due to the additional components required for the cooling mechanism.

3 Control System

The control system of a benchtop lyophilizer also plays a crucial role in determining its price Advanced control systems with features such as touchscreen interfaces, programmable cycles, and data logging capabilities tend to be more expensive compared to basic control systems benchtop lyophilizer price. The level of automation and customization offered by the control system can significantly impact the overall cost of the lyophilizer.

4 Vacuum System

The vacuum system is another essential component of a benchtop lyophilizer that affects its price The vacuum system is responsible for creating and maintaining the low-pressure environment necessary for the freeze-drying process High-quality vacuum pumps and chambers can drive up the cost of a lyophilizer, but they are crucial for achieving optimal results during freeze-drying.

5 Brand and Manufacturer

The brand and manufacturer of a benchtop lyophilizer can also impact its price Established brands with a reputation for producing high-quality laboratory equipment may charge a premium for their products compared to lesser-known manufacturers However, investing in a reputable brand can provide assurance of product quality, reliability, and customer support, which may justify the higher price tag.

6 Additional Features

Additional features and accessories offered with a benchtop lyophilizer can contribute to its overall cost Features such as shelf heating, temperature mapping, and shelf stoppering systems can enhance the functionality and performance of the lyophilizer but may come at an additional cost Buyers should carefully consider the necessity of these extra features and weigh them against the price of the lyophilizer.

In conclusion, the price of a benchtop lyophilizer is influenced by various factors, including capacity, cooling system, control system, vacuum system, brand, manufacturer, and additional features When considering purchasing a benchtop lyophilizer, it is essential to evaluate these factors and determine the specific requirements of your laboratory to make an informed decision Investing in a high-quality lyophilizer may require a significant upfront cost, but it can provide long-term benefits in terms of efficiency, productivity, and sample integrity.

Importance Of Biosecurity In Agriculture

Biosecurity in agriculture is a crucial aspect of modern farming practices. It entails measures implemented to protect plants, animals, and humans from pests, diseases, and other biological threats. Biosecurity in agriculture helps to maintain the health and productivity of crops and livestock and prevents the spread of harmful pathogens. In this article, we will discuss some examples of biosecurity in agriculture and their importance.

1. Quarantine and Inspections
One of the primary biosecurity measures in agriculture is quarantine and inspections. Quarantine involves isolating new plants or animals entering a farm to prevent the introduction of diseases or pests. Inspections are carried out on animals, plants, and equipment to ensure they meet biosecurity standards before they are allowed on the farm. This helps to prevent the introduction and spread of harmful pathogens that can devastate crops and livestock.

2. Controlled Access
Limiting access to farms is another important biosecurity measure. Controlling access to farms through restricted entry points helps to reduce the risk of introducing diseases or pests. Farmers can also implement biosecurity protocols for visitors, such as requiring them to clean and disinfect their footwear and clothing before entering the premises. These measures help prevent the transmission of diseases between farms and protect the health of plants and animals.

3. Cleaning and Disinfection
Regular cleaning and disinfection of equipment, tools, and vehicles are essential biosecurity practices in agriculture. Contaminated equipment can spread diseases and pests from one area of the farm to another. By cleaning and disinfecting equipment regularly, farmers can reduce the risk of disease transmission and protect the health of their crops and livestock. Using appropriate disinfectants and following proper cleaning protocols are crucial for effective biosecurity in agriculture.

4. Pest and Disease Monitoring
Monitoring pests and diseases is a key aspect of biosecurity in agriculture. Regular surveillance and monitoring help farmers detect and respond to potential threats before they become widespread. By keeping track of pest and disease populations, farmers can implement control measures in a timely manner to prevent outbreaks and minimize damage to crops or livestock. Early detection and effective management of pests and diseases are essential for maintaining the health and productivity of agricultural operations.

5. Genetic Resistance
Developing plants and animals with genetic resistance to pests and diseases is an important biosecurity strategy in agriculture. By breeding crops and livestock for resistance to specific pathogens, farmers can reduce the need for chemical interventions and minimize the risk of disease outbreaks. Genetic resistance helps to protect crops and livestock from common pests and diseases, ensuring higher yields and sustainable production practices.

6. Risk Assessment and Management
Conducting risk assessments and implementing risk management strategies are essential components of biosecurity in agriculture. Farmers should identify potential risks to their crops and livestock, such as diseases, pests, and environmental factors, and develop plans to mitigate those risks. By assessing the likelihood and impact of various threats, farmers can prioritize biosecurity measures and allocate resources effectively to protect their operations.

7. Biosecurity Training and Education
Providing training and education on biosecurity practices is crucial for promoting awareness and compliance among farmers and farm workers. Training programs can help individuals understand the importance of biosecurity in agriculture and learn how to implement best practices on their farms. By educating farmers about biosecurity protocols, regulations, and the consequences of non-compliance, agricultural stakeholders can work together to reduce the spread of diseases and pests and safeguard the health of plants and animals.

In conclusion, biosecurity is a critical component of modern agriculture that helps to protect plants, animals, and humans from biological threats. By implementing biosecurity measures such as quarantine and inspections, controlled access, cleaning and disinfection, pest and disease monitoring, genetic resistance, risk assessment and management, and training and education, farmers can effectively safeguard their operations and ensure the health and productivity of their crops and livestock. It is essential for agricultural stakeholders to prioritize biosecurity in their operations to minimize the risk of disease outbreaks and promote sustainable farming practices.

Everything You Need To Know About Lip Seals

Lip seals play a crucial role in a wide range of applications, from automotive to industrial machinery. Also known as radial shaft seals, lip seals are designed to prevent the leakage of fluids and gases in rotating or reciprocating shafts. In this article, we will explore what lip seals are, how they work, and their importance in various industries.

What is a lip seal?

A lip seal is a type of sealing device that is used to prevent the escape of fluid or gas along a rotating or reciprocating shaft. It consists of a flexible lip that makes contact with the shaft, creating a barrier that prevents the passage of contaminants. Lip seals are typically made of materials such as rubber, silicone, or polyurethane, which are chosen based on the specific application requirements.

How Does a lip seal Work?

Lip seals work by exerting a slight radial pressure on the shaft, creating a tight seal that prevents the leakage of fluids or gases. The lip of the seal is designed to conform to the shaft’s surface, ensuring a secure fit that minimizes the risk of leakage. When the shaft rotates or moves, the lip seal flexes to maintain contact with the shaft, providing continuous protection against contaminants.

Importance of lip seals in Various Industries

Lip seals are used in a wide range of industries to prevent the leakage of fluids and gases in rotating or reciprocating shafts. Some of the key industries that rely on lip seals include:

Automotive: Lip seals are commonly used in vehicles to prevent the leakage of oil, coolant, and other fluids in the engine, transmission, and other components. They play a crucial role in ensuring the proper functioning of automotive systems and reducing the risk of equipment failure.

Industrial Machinery: In industrial machinery such as pumps, compressors, and gearboxes, lip seals are essential for preventing the escape of lubricants and other fluids. They help maintain the efficiency and reliability of machinery by protecting critical components from contamination.

Aerospace: Lip seals are also used in aerospace applications to seal rotating shafts in aircraft engines, turbines, and other systems. They help maintain the integrity of critical components in high-performance aerospace systems.

Medical Devices: Lip seals play a vital role in medical devices such as pumps, ventilators, and diagnostic equipment. They ensure the safe and reliable operation of medical devices by preventing the escape of fluids and gases.

Tips for Choosing the Right Lip Seal

When selecting a lip seal for a specific application, it is essential to consider factors such as temperature, pressure, speed, and the type of fluid or gas being sealed. Here are some tips for choosing the right lip seal:

1. Material Selection: Choose a material that is compatible with the fluid or gas being sealed and can withstand the temperature and pressure conditions of the application.

2. Lip Design: Select a lip design that is suitable for the shaft speed and direction of rotation. Different lip profiles, such as single lip, double lip, or spring-loaded lip, offer varying levels of sealing effectiveness.

3. Size and Fit: Ensure that the lip seal is properly sized and installed to provide a secure fit on the shaft. Proper installation is critical for achieving the desired sealing performance.

In conclusion, lip seals are essential components that play a crucial role in preventing the leakage of fluids and gases in rotating or reciprocating shafts. They are used in a wide range of industries to ensure the reliability and efficiency of systems and equipment. By understanding how lip seals work and choosing the right seal for a specific application, manufacturers can achieve optimal sealing performance and prevent costly downtime.

The Versatile Material: Nylon 6 Polymer

nylon 6 polymer, commonly referred to as nylon 6, is a synthetic polymer that has gained popularity for its wide range of applications across various industries. It is part of the nylon family, which includes other variations such as nylon 6,6 and nylon 6,12. nylon 6 polymer is known for its excellent strength, durability, and resistance to abrasion, making it a highly sought-after material for manufacturers worldwide.

One of the key characteristics of nylon 6 polymer is its high tensile strength, which makes it an ideal material for applications that require robust and durable components. Its strength surpasses that of natural fibers like cotton or silk, making it a popular choice for products that need to withstand heavy loads or frequent use. This characteristic has made nylon 6 polymer a common choice for products like ropes, cables, automotive parts, and protective gear in sports equipment.

In addition to its high tensile strength, nylon 6 polymer also exhibits excellent resistance to abrasion and impact. This makes it a practical choice for applications that involve friction or repeated contact, as it can withstand wear and tear over an extended period. For this reason, nylon 6 polymer is often used in the manufacturing of gears, bearings, conveyor belts, and other mechanical components that require a material with high durability.

Another key advantage of nylon 6 polymer is its versatility in terms of processing and customization. It can be easily molded into various shapes and sizes, allowing manufacturers to create complex components with intricate designs. This flexibility makes nylon 6 polymer a popular choice for injection molding, extrusion, and other manufacturing processes that require precision and consistency. As a result, nylon 6 polymer is used in a wide range of industries, from automotive and aerospace to consumer goods and electronics.

Furthermore, nylon 6 polymer is known for its excellent chemical and moisture resistance, making it suitable for applications that involve exposure to harsh environments or chemicals. It does not degrade easily when exposed to oils, solvents, or prolonged moisture, making it a reliable choice for products that need to maintain their integrity under challenging conditions. This resistance to chemicals and moisture has made nylon 6 polymer a preferred material for applications like fuel lines, chemical tanks, and protective coatings.

In terms of sustainability, nylon 6 polymer is known for its recyclability and eco-friendly properties. It can be easily recycled and reused to create new products, reducing the need for virgin materials and minimizing waste. Additionally, nylon 6 polymer can be produced using renewable energy sources and bio-based feedstocks, further reducing its environmental impact. As the demand for sustainable materials continues to grow, nylon 6 polymer is poised to play a significant role in the development of eco-friendly products and solutions.

Despite its many advantages, nylon 6 polymer does have some limitations that should be taken into consideration. It has a relatively high melting point, which can make it challenging to process at lower temperatures or in certain manufacturing environments. Additionally, nylon 6 polymer is prone to moisture absorption, which can affect its mechanical properties and dimensional stability over time. Manufacturers must take these factors into account when selecting nylon 6 polymer for specific applications and adjust their processing parameters accordingly.

In conclusion, nylon 6 polymer is a versatile material that offers a unique combination of strength, durability, and resistance to abrasion. Its wide range of applications and customizable properties make it a popular choice for manufacturers across various industries. As the demand for high-performance materials continues to grow, nylon 6 polymer is expected to remain a key player in the global market. With ongoing advancements in processing techniques and sustainability initiatives, nylon 6 polymer is set to continue evolving and expanding its role in the manufacturing sector.

One of the primary reasons why tankless water heaters are gaining popularity is their energy efficiency. Unlike traditional tank water heaters that constantly need to heat and reheat water stored in a tank, tankless water heaters heat water on demand. This means that they only heat water when you need it, eliminating standby heat loss and reducing energy consumption. In fact, tankless water heaters can be up to 30% more energy efficient than traditional tank water heaters, helping you save money on your utility bills in the long run.

Another key advantage of a tankless water heater is its space-saving design. Traditional tank water heaters can take up a significant amount of space in your home, especially if you have a small living area. In contrast, tankless water heaters are compact and can be mounted on a wall, freeing up valuable floor space. This makes them ideal for smaller homes or apartments where space is limited.

In addition to their energy efficiency and space-saving design, tankless water heaters also provide a continuous supply of hot water. With a tankless water heater, you will never run out of hot water, no matter how many showers, baths, or appliances are running simultaneously. This is especially beneficial for larger households where hot water demand is high, ensuring that everyone can enjoy hot water whenever they need it.

Furthermore, tankless water heaters have a longer lifespan compared to traditional tank water heaters. While traditional tank water heaters typically last around 10-15 years, tankless water heaters can last up to 20 years with proper maintenance. This means that you won’t have to worry about replacing your water heater as often, saving you time and money in the long term.

When it comes to installation and maintenance, tankless water heaters are also more convenient than traditional tank water heaters. Tankless water heaters are generally smaller and lighter than tank water heaters, making them easier to install in tight spaces. Additionally, tankless water heaters require less maintenance as they do not have a storage tank that can rust or leak over time. This means that you will spend less time and money on maintenance and repairs, further enhancing the cost-effectiveness of a tankless water heater.

Maximizing Health And Performance: The Importance Of Equine Feed Supplements

equine feed supplements play a crucial role in ensuring the health and performance of horses. Just like humans, horses require a balanced diet to meet their nutritional needs and support their overall well-being. While a good quality forage is the foundation of a horse’s diet, feed supplements can provide additional nutrients and support for specific health and performance goals.

There are many reasons why equine feed supplements may be necessary. Some horses may have dietary restrictions due to medical conditions or allergies, while others may have increased nutritional requirements due to growth, pregnancy, lactation, or intense exercise. In these cases, feed supplements can help bridge the nutritional gaps and ensure that the horse is getting all the essential nutrients it needs to thrive.

One of the most common reasons for using equine feed supplements is to support the horse’s joints and overall musculoskeletal health. Horses are incredibly athletic animals, and the demands of training and competition can put a significant strain on their joints. Joint supplements containing ingredients such as glucosamine, chondroitin, and hyaluronic acid can help support healthy cartilage and reduce inflammation, thereby promoting improved joint function and mobility.

Another popular use for equine feed supplements is to support digestive health. Horses have delicate digestive systems that can easily be disrupted by factors such as changes in diet, stress, or medications. Digestive supplements containing probiotics, prebiotics, and digestive enzymes can help maintain a healthy gut flora, improve nutrient absorption, and prevent digestive issues such as colic or ulcers.

In addition to joint and digestive health, equine feed supplements can also be used to support other aspects of a horse’s well-being. For example, supplements containing vitamins, minerals, and amino acids can help fill in any nutritional gaps in the horse’s diet and support overall health and vitality. Other supplements, such as those containing omega-3 fatty acids or antioxidants, can support the horse’s immune system, improve skin and coat condition, and reduce inflammation.

When choosing equine feed supplements for your horse, it’s essential to consider their individual needs and goals. Consult with your veterinarian or equine nutritionist to determine which supplements are appropriate for your horse based on factors such as age, breed, size, health status, activity level, and dietary habits. It’s also important to select high-quality supplements from reputable manufacturers to ensure their safety, efficacy, and consistency.

In addition to choosing the right supplements, it’s crucial to follow the recommended dosage instructions and feeding guidelines provided by the manufacturer. Over-supplementation can be just as harmful as under-supplementation and may lead to nutrient imbalances or toxicity. Monitor your horse’s response to the supplements and make adjustments as needed to ensure that they are benefiting from them appropriately.

While equine feed supplements can provide many benefits, they should not be used as a substitute for a balanced diet. A good quality forage should always be the foundation of a horse’s diet, with supplements used to complement and enhance their nutritional intake. Regularly evaluating your horse’s diet and adjusting their supplementation regimen as needed is essential to ensure that they are receiving the right nutrients in the right amounts.

In conclusion, equine feed supplements play a crucial role in maintaining the health and performance of horses. Whether supporting joints, digestion, immunity, or overall well-being, supplements can help meet the specific nutritional needs of individual horses and optimize their health and performance goals. By working closely with your veterinarian or equine nutritionist and selecting high-quality supplements from reputable manufacturers, you can ensure that your horse is getting the nutrients they need to thrive.
